Mysql kapcsolótáblás lekérdezés?
Lenne egy cimke tábla, egy kapcsolótábla és egy cikkek tábla.
cimke -> cid,cname
kapcsolótábla -> kid,ktid,kaid
cikkek -> aid (ennyi kell csak belőle)
Ebből kellene nekem olyan lekérdezést írni ami ha meg van adva a cimke id-je akkor a kapcsolótáblán keresztül lekérdezi az adott cimkéhez tartozó cikkeket.
inner join-al próbáltam bár azt nem nagyon értem.
sikerült megoldani, általában így van... felteszem a kérdést utána rá megoldódik (na nem mindig...)
Sikeresen hülyének nézettem magam,beszélgetek magammal...
azért leírhatnád a többieknek, ha valaki idetéved, és akkor még hülyének se néznének..
(mellesleg a ktid az gondolom kcid akar lenni, még ha nem is nagyon értem ezt az elnevezést, és valahogy így: select cikkek.aid from cikkek join kapcsolotabla k on k.aid = cikkek.aid where k.kcid=valami)
$tag_SQL = "select * from tag_to_article inner join tags on tag_to_article.tag_id = ".$url." inner join articles on tag_to_article.article_id = articles.article_id group by articles.article_id ".$limit."";
$url = cimke id-je
két tábla van tag to article és az articles
Kapcsolódó kérdések:
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!